United announce side to face Partizan

Thursday 24 October 2019 16:37

Manchester United manager Ole Gunnar Solskjaer has named his starting line-up for the Europa League Group L game at Partizan Belgrade.

James Garner makes his first start in midfield, while Ole sticks with three at the back - a system he employed in Sunday's draw against Liverpool.

Phil Jones is drafted in to replace Victor Lindelof in the backline, with Harry Maguire and Marcos Rojo keeping their places. Summer signing Maguire captains the side for the first time.

"Harry's a leader and we brought him to the club to take us one step further," the boss told MUTV. "So far, he's been brilliant and hopefully this captain's armband will help him maybe become a bigger leader as he's been excellent since he came." 

Birkenhead-born James Garner has been outstanding for the Under-23s.

Aaron Wan-Bissaka and Brandon Williams will be asked to provide the width as attacking full-backs.

Garner, who has added goals to his game this term and been in magnificent form for the Under-23s, has only had a few seconds of first-team experience - as a late substitute at Crystal Palace last February.

However, he starts in midfield with another homegrown talent, Scott McTominay, and Juan Mata. Jesse Lingard, who is back from injury, looks set to push forward to support Anthony Martial. The Frenchman is in the XI for the first time since the Premier League game against Crystal Palace on 24 August.

"He's been excellent," said Ole of Garner. "He's been waiting for his chance and we felt tonight, with the experience he has around him, will be a good start for him. I think he's got more or less 300 caps out there next to him. I don’t think he's ever played with so much experience around him. He's an exciting player."

There is plenty of ammunition on the bench, with Marcus Rashford and Daniel James waiting on the wings after their exertions at Old Trafford last weekend.

United: Romero; Jones, Maguire, Rojo; Wan-Bissaka, McTominay, Garner, Mata, Williams; Lingard, Martial.

Substitutes: Grant, Lindelof, Andreas, Fred, James, Greenwood, Rashford.
